For fun, I would like to build my own single-board computer which I can later program. I know there are already many development kits out there, sold by companies such as Altera and Xilinx, but I want to try to build such a board from scratch.
I'm aiming for something very simple. It should have system clock running on perhaps 1MHz, an 8-bit CPU (onchip multiply-and-divide unit is not required; I can simulate that in software), a small RAM (some KB should be enough) and an EEPROM where I can store my program. I would also like to connect some sensors, for example to read the temperature in the room.
I have read some digital design and CPU architecture courses, so I'm not worried about the components themselves. What I am worried about is the interconnects, especially if I need resistors and capacitors inbetween. I have some experience with analog circuitry, but it is limited. I have built my own board once for controlling four fans in my computer case using some opamps and resistors.
I don't mind writing my own compiler if need be, but it makes things much easier if such is already available. Also, getting the program on the EEPROM might be a bit difficult...
Do you know of any good books, websites or other resources to point me to in order to learn how to build my own single-board computer? Any help is much appreciated.
